# 使用 Python 的 Logging 模块处理时间戳
在编程中,记录日志是一项重要的技能,它可以帮助我们追踪程序的执行过程,并发现潜在的问题。Python 的 `logging` 模块是一个非常强大且灵活的工具,可以轻松地记录各种信息。本篇文章将教你如何在 Python 中实现带有时间戳的日志记录功能。以下是完成此项任务的步骤,以及所需的代码示例。
## 步骤流程
| 步骤 | 描述
原创
2024-10-11 09:30:24
37阅读
# Python Logging时间戳实现指南
在软件开发中,日志记录是一个非常重要的功能,它能帮助我们追踪程序的执行过程和排查问题。Python内置的`logging`模块提供了灵活的日志记录功能,包括可自定义的时间戳。本文将教你如何在Python中实现带有时间戳的日志记录。
## 流程概述
我们将通过以下几个步骤实现Python logging时间戳功能:
| 步骤 | 描述 |
|-
TimedRotatingFileHandler 是 Python 官方提供的一个可以基于时间自动切分日志的 Handler 类。但是它是没有办法支持多进程的日志切换,多进程进行日志切换的时候会丢失日志数据,导致日志错乱。在win10上还会报错:‘win32Error : 文件被占用的错误’.我们先好好看看源码,究竟是什么问题导致它的线程不安全:class TimedRotatingF
转载
2023-10-03 18:43:50
97阅读
我前面有篇文章已经详细介绍了一下 Python 的日志模块。Python 提供了非常多的可以运用在各种不同场景的 Log Handler.TimedRotatingFileHandler 是 Python 提供的一个可以基于时间自动切分日志的 Handler 类,他继承自 BaseRotatingHandler -> logging.FileHandler但是他有一个缺点
转载
2023-10-31 14:48:54
41阅读
# Python Logging 时间戳格式科普
在Python编程中,日志记录是一个重要的功能,它可以帮助开发者追踪程序的运行情况,及时发现和解决问题。Python的`logging`模块提供了灵活的日志记录功能,包括设置日志级别、输出格式等。其中,时间戳是日志记录中不可或缺的一部分,它记录了日志信息产生的时间点。本文将详细介绍如何在Python中设置和自定义日志的时间戳格式。
## 旅行图
原创
2024-07-29 03:46:15
115阅读
# Python Logging 时间戳微秒
在Python中,logging模块是一个内置的日志记录功能,可以用来记录应用程序中的各种信息。其中一个重要的功能是可以在日志中包含时间戳,以便更好地跟踪日志的生成时间。在这篇文章中,我们将介绍如何在Python中使用logging模块来记录带有微秒级时间戳的日志,并给出相应的代码示例。
## logging模块简介
logging模块是Pyth
原创
2024-03-14 05:29:32
181阅读
一、StreamHandler流handler——包含在logging模块中的三个handler之一。 能够将日志信息输出到sys.stdout, sys.stderr 或者类文件对象(更确切点,就是能够支持write()和flush()方法的对象)。 只有一个参数:class logging.StreamHandler(stream=None) 日志信息会输出到指定的stream中,如果stre
转载
2024-10-08 15:13:23
80阅读
# Python Logging 显示时间戳
## 概述
在Python开发中,使用日志记录(Logging)是一个非常重要的技能。通过记录重要的程序运行信息,我们可以更加方便地进行故障排查和问题定位。其中一个常见的需求是在日志中显示时间戳,以便更好地跟踪日志事件。本文将向你介绍如何在Python中使用logging模块来实现显示时间戳的功能。
## 实现步骤
下面是实现“Python Lo
原创
2023-07-23 11:05:19
1693阅读
# Python Logging 增加时间戳的完全指南
在很多应用程序中,日志记录是一个非常重要的部分。通过记录程序的运行状态、错误信息和调试信息,我们可以更好地分析和排查问题。在 Python 中,`logging` 模块是内置的日志记录模块,它为我们提供了丰富的功能和灵活的配置选项。本文将帮助您了解如何使用 Python 的 `logging` 模块记录带有时间戳的日志信息。
## 为什么
原创
2024-09-10 07:08:27
170阅读
在使用 Python 的 logging 模块时,经常会遇到需要处理时间戳的问题,尤其是在日志记录过程中,时间格式的标准化、时区处理等会影响日志的可读性与分析。本文将以全面的结构探讨如何有效地备份、恢复和监控日志,同时将重点放在时间戳处理上。
## 备份策略
为了确保日志数据的安全性和可追溯性,我们需要设计有效的备份策略。以下展示了相关的思维导图,直观地呈现出备份的全局策略及存储架构。
``
# Python中的日志记录:文件名带时间戳
在Python编程中,日志记录是一种非常重要的技术,它可以帮助我们追踪应用程序的运行过程,排查错误和问题。在实际开发中,我们经常会遇到需要将日志记录到文件中,并且文件名需要带有时间戳的情况。本文将介绍如何在Python中使用logging模块实现这一功能。
## logging模块简介
logging模块是Python标准库中的日志记录模块,它提
原创
2024-03-23 05:19:13
322阅读
# Python logging 时间实现教程
## 1. 整体流程
下面是实现“python logging 时间”的整体流程:
| 步骤 | 描述 |
| :-: | :-- |
| 1 | 导入logging模块 |
| 2 | 配置日志输出格式 |
| 3 | 创建日志记录器 |
| 4 | 创建文件处理器 |
| 5 | 设置文件处理器的日志级别 |
| 6 | 将处理器添加到记录
原创
2023-09-27 21:47:54
141阅读
# Python Logging 记录时间
在Python中,`logging`模块是一个非常有用的工具,用于记录程序运行时的各种信息,例如警告、错误、调试信息等。通过使用`logging`模块,我们可以很方便地将这些信息输出到控制台、文件等不同的地方。在实际应用中,记录时间是非常重要的,因为它可以帮助我们更好地了解程序的运行状态以及排查问题。本文将介绍如何在Python中使用`logging`
原创
2024-05-12 03:41:10
88阅读
# Python Logging系统时间
日志是软件开发过程中非常重要的一部分,可以帮助我们追踪程序的执行情况,记录重要的事件和错误信息。在Python中,logging模块提供了一种灵活且功能强大的日志记录方式。本文将介绍如何使用Python logging模块来记录系统时间。
## logging模块简介
Python的logging模块提供了标准的日志记录功能,可以方便地在代码中添加日
原创
2023-08-31 05:26:49
176阅读
# Python logging 时间格式实现
## 1. 概述
本文将介绍如何在Python中实现自定义的时间格式,用于日志记录。我们将通过以下几个步骤来完成这个任务:
1. 创建一个Logger对象
2. 创建一个Formatter对象
3. 创建一个Handler对象
4. 将Formatter对象添加到Handler对象中
5. 将Handler对象添加到Logger对象中
6. 设
原创
2024-01-30 10:17:43
69阅读
# Python Logging打印时间
作为一名经验丰富的开发者,我将教你如何在Python中使用logging模块打印时间。下面是一个简单的步骤表格,展示了整个过程:
步骤 | 操作
--- | ---
1 | 导入logging模块
2 | 配置logging模块
3 | 创建logger对象
4 | 创建handler对象
5 | 创建formatter对象
6 | 将formatte
原创
2024-01-06 06:34:26
268阅读
# Python Logging 加上时间
## 简介
在编写代码时,我们经常需要添加日志来跟踪程序的执行情况和调试错误。Python内置的logging模块提供了强大的日志功能,可以方便地记录日志信息。本文将向你介绍如何在Python的日志中添加时间戳。
## 步骤概览
下面是实现"python logging 加上时间"的步骤概览表格:
| 步骤 | 描述 |
| --- | --- |
原创
2023-09-12 13:19:33
1001阅读
# Python Logging 配置时间
日志是开发和维护应用程序时必不可少的工具之一。它可以记录应用程序的运行状态、错误信息以及其他有用的信息。Python 提供了一个内置的 logging 模块,用于创建灵活的日志记录器。logging 模块可以配置多种日志记录行为,其中之一是日志记录的时间格式。
本文将介绍如何使用 Python logging 模块配置日志记录的时间格式,并提供相应的
原创
2023-08-23 13:04:49
280阅读
# Python Logging 时间格式实现指南
在开发过程中,日志记录是一项非常重要的工作。Python 的 logging 模块提供了强大的日志功能。本文将帮助你了解如何自定义 Python logging 中的时间格式,让你的日志更加清晰和易于分析。
## 实现流程
我们可以将整个流程分为以下几个步骤:
| 步骤 | 描述 |
|------|------|
| 1 | 导入
原创
2024-09-06 05:36:10
62阅读
# Python Logging显示时间
在Python中,logging模块是一个非常有用的工具,用于记录和输出程序的日志信息。日志是开发者用来追踪代码执行过程中的问题和错误的重要工具。默认情况下,logging模块输出的日志信息中并不包含时间戳,但是我们可以通过简单的设置来显示时间。
## 1. logging模块概述
logging模块是Python内置的模块,提供了一个灵活且完整的日
原创
2024-01-20 10:28:27
304阅读